Default 2.0 zetec xr2i?

Hi everyone, just wondering does anyone know if its possible to fit a 2.0 zetec
into a mk3 1.8i 16v fiesta xr2i? and what kind of work would be involved

dont need a 2ltr ecu at all for it to run, you do need the 1.8ltr sump and oil pick up as the sump bowl is on a different side to accomodate the front pipe, the water pump flows in a different direction on the 1.8 which is why you need to change this too, also keep your original inlet and get an rs1800 throttle body as they`re bigger, if you do fit an rs1800 ecu make sure its correct as the earlier rs 1800 and 2i had similar ecu description one is 2fdc the other 2fcd cant remember which is which, when you fit these you need to rev the engine at 2,500 rpm for around 20 min for it to program itself to suit the engine, you will hear the revs alter several times even though your foot will be in the same position,if you just plug in the ecu and run it,it will be ok til around 3,000rpm then it will feel like its holding back,its well worth doing as i had a 2ltr 2i a couple of years ago and it was so much quicker than standard, especially midrange, you could also dump the exhaust manifold if it has the egr pipes on it as they poke quite far into the exhaust ports restricting gas flow, can find a non egr manifold on some escort 1.8si`s but not all hope this helps,roy
